Job Duties

  • Coordinate, plan, and oversee the safe production, preparation and presentation of food for exceptional guest experience and increased flow through
  • Complete daily market lists to ensure quality food ordering while maintaining budgeted costs
  • Interact closely with the Catering department to assist in function menu coordination and meet with clients as required
  • Work with the Executive Chef to improve processes that increase safety and optimize profitability
  • Lead a diverse team by modeling the way, by empowering, and coaching throughout the employment lifecycle
  • Balance operational, administrative and colleague needs
  • Follow kitchen policies, procedures and service standards
  • Ensure labor and food costs fall within budget and kitchen equipment functions properly for associate safety and increased productivity
  • Develop, mentor, coach staff on an ongoing basis
  • Work closely and cohesively with the front of the house
  • Manage food cost
  • Develop recipes
  • Assist Sous Chef/ Executive Sous Chef with departmental payroll, scheduling and administration
